NBA - 501 Utah Jazz @ 502 Philadelphia 76ers

Play #1

It was tough to lose the Over play last night w/ the Jazz as they were stuck @76 points for about 6 minutes in the fourth quarter. For tonight, I’m going again playing the Over in their contest against PHI.

This is going to be UTA’s 3rd game in 4 nights – b2b spot and the last game of their road trip, so we are dealing w/ a potential “letdown” spot for them. Nevertheless, after being spanked in L3 games, I expect them to be “fired up” for this contest.

The 76ers’ game plan is pretty easy to predict: they will as usual push the pace in every opportunity especially taking in account that they will face a “tired team”.

Now, we have to figure out the key question for tonight, can PHI score efficiently tonight?

Well, we all know that PHI really can’t shoot from the outside… their 24.0% 3pts mark in L10 games is by far the worst mark in the league! They can only score via transition and attacking the rim…

The good news is that the Jazz is a bad team protecting the rim and they are ranked #22 in transition defense. In the L3 games, UTA’s defensive rating = 137.8, 121.2 & 122.4!

Matchup wise…PHI’s best 2 offensive players Michael Carter-Williams and Thaddeus Young will have favorable matchups vs. rookie T. Burke & Marvin Williams.

On the other end, I don’t think that UTA will have any problem in scoring vs. PHI awful defense and therefore, I’m taking the Over in his contest as my Single Dime Play.

NBA - 507 Orlando Magic @ 508 San Antonio Spurs

Play #2 & #3

Last Thursday I went with the Spurs for an easy winner, as they really crushed the Heat by 24 points!!! They are now healthy and their offensive flow has been amazing – they had 34, 26, 28, 39 and 30 assists in L5 games!

Against the Heat, not only SAS’s starters completely outplayed the Heat, but also SAS’s 2nd unit of Mills, Ginobili, Belinelli and Splitter ended the game all w/ +/- team points of + double digits points.

With such remarkable offensive momentum right now, how in the hell will the Magic slow down SAS’s offense?! Well, they won’t!

ORL will be without rookie Oladipo for tonight and their bad perimeter defense will be torched by the Spurs. In the last game vs. a tired Rockets team that was playing @b2b spot,  ORL outscored HOU 31-19 in the first quarter just to be crushed 57-82 in the remaining 3 quarters of the game.

Jameer Nelson will return tonight and while this is a good thing for ORL’s offense, Tony Parker is smiling right now and waiting for this contest.

SAS has won their L2 games by 21 and 24 points against better teams than ORL, my fair line for this contest is SAS by 20 points while I’m taking the Over as SAS offense will put another terrific show on the court.
